Transaction 102720e270a9ecbac973ee39033cc43782dc51c63707491b81d6f183e1b65ada
1 Input
1 Output
-
102720e270a9ecbac973ee39033cc43782dc51c63707491b81d6f183e1b65ada:0
- value
- 6468639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29c3e4c61d17ef13fee162ad13a79f2967fa1587 OP_EQUAL
- address
- 35VrJLZYiC3eDwUzukw2njbFszJHUrpmcQ